What the Data Says About 1996

The Social Security Administration's national 1996 file shows 1,933,535 births concentrated in the top 100 boy and top 100 girl names, the segment of U.S. baby-name data released to the public for that year. The #1 boy name of 1996 was Michael, with 38,373 births registered nationally. The #1 girl name of 1996 was Emily, with 25,150 births nationally. The top 100 boys captured 1,118,041 births compared with 815,494 for the top 100 girls — consistent with the historical SSA pattern in which a smaller pool of boy names dominates a larger share of annual births while girl names are more evenly distributed.

1996 sits within a specific era of U.S. naming trends. Late-20th-century years like 1996 reflect accelerating naming diversification, with Jennifer, Jessica, Michael, and Christopher giving way to more varied choices and the gradual fragmentation of top-10 dominance. Michael and Emily leading 1996 fits this broader cultural signature.

These rankings come directly from Social Security Administration card applications and represent approximately 96% of all U.S. births in 1996. Names with fewer than five occurrences nationally in 1996 are excluded from SSA's public file to protect privacy, meaning the true number of unique names given in 1996 is significantly larger than any public top-100 list can show. Each spelling variation is counted separately — Sophia and Sofia, Aiden and Ayden — so rankings reflect only the specific spelling filed on the SS card, not combined name pools. Top 100 Boys' Names Boy

Rank Name Births
1 Michael 38,373
2 Matthew 32,077
3 Jacob 31,924
4 Christopher 30,902
5 Joshua 29,174
6 Nicholas 27,722
7 Tyler 26,955
8 Brandon 25,847
9 Austin 25,663
10 Andrew 25,244
11 Daniel 25,125
12 Joseph 24,758
13 David 23,024
14 Zachary 22,368
15 John 22,186
16 Ryan 21,810
17 James 21,164
18 William 20,544
19 Anthony 20,507
20 Justin 20,011
21 Jonathan 18,602
22 Alexander 17,964
23 Robert 17,676
24 Christian 15,823
25 Kyle 15,600
26 Kevin 14,589
27 Jordan 13,852
28 Thomas 13,805
29 Benjamin 13,785
30 Samuel 13,629
31 Cody 12,953
32 Jose 12,155
33 Dylan 12,037
34 Aaron 11,971
35 Eric 11,610
36 Brian 10,476
37 Nathan 10,285
38 Steven 9,649
39 Adam 9,557
40 Timothy 8,919
41 Jason 8,696
42 Logan 8,374
43 Charles 8,247
44 Patrick 8,193
45 Richard 8,180
46 Sean 7,896
47 Hunter 7,603
48 Caleb 7,549
49 Cameron 7,388
50 Noah 7,184
51 Jesse 7,075
52 Juan 7,010
53 Alex 6,915
54 Connor 6,911
55 Mark 6,599
56 Jeremy 6,412
57 Luis 6,407
58 Dakota 6,067
59 Stephen 6,008
60 Devin 6,002
61 Gabriel 5,899
62 Ethan 5,853
63 Trevor 5,842
64 Jared 5,821
65 Evan 5,578
66 Bryan 5,560
67 Carlos 5,464
68 Tristan 5,458
69 Nathaniel 5,420
70 Ian 5,410
71 Isaiah 5,324
72 Jeffrey 5,263
73 Travis 5,159
74 Jesus 5,114
75 Luke 5,017
76 Chase 4,991
77 Kenneth 4,973
78 Paul 4,883
79 Dustin 4,874
80 Antonio 4,866
81 Elijah 4,818
82 Taylor 4,798
83 Bradley 4,756
84 Blake 4,747
85 Garrett 4,653
86 Isaac 4,565
87 Marcus 4,547
88 Mitchell 4,391
89 Jack 4,245
90 Tanner 4,180
91 Miguel 4,160
92 Adrian 4,109
93 Lucas 4,106
94 Corey 4,087
95 Peter 4,082
96 Edward 4,073
97 Malik 4,026
98 Gregory 3,994
99 Dalton 3,980
100 Victor 3,924

Top 100 Girls' Names Girl

Rank Name Births
1 Emily 25,150
2 Jessica 24,200
3 Ashley 23,678
4 Sarah 21,044
5 Samantha 20,551
6 Taylor 19,153
7 Hannah 18,596
8 Alexis 16,592
9 Rachel 16,120
10 Elizabeth 16,004
11 Kayla 15,269
12 Megan 14,770
13 Amanda 13,980
14 Brittany 13,797
15 Madison 13,410
16 Lauren 12,594
17 Brianna 11,925
18 Victoria 11,859
19 Jennifer 11,729
20 Stephanie 11,644
21 Courtney 11,344
22 Nicole 11,134
23 Alyssa 11,024
24 Rebecca 10,626
25 Morgan 10,295
26 Alexandra 10,024
27 Amber 9,771
28 Jasmine 9,707
29 Danielle 9,285
30 Haley 9,042
31 Katherine 8,878
32 Abigail 8,604
33 Anna 8,574
34 Olivia 8,125
35 Shelby 7,950
36 Kelsey 7,655
37 Maria 7,597
38 Allison 7,455
39 Sydney 7,259
40 Kaitlyn 7,241
41 Kimberly 7,175
42 Melissa 7,170
43 Savannah 7,000
44 Mary 6,967
45 Brooke 6,724
46 Natalie 6,693
47 Michelle 6,598
48 Julia 6,314
49 Jordan 6,299
50 Sara 6,288
51 Erin 6,256
52 Tiffany 6,158
53 Emma 6,150
54 Gabrielle 5,888
55 Chelsea 5,864
56 Destiny 5,856
57 Christina 5,804
58 Sabrina 5,774
59 Marissa 5,753
60 Vanessa 5,746
61 Andrea 5,671
62 Sierra 5,487
63 Mariah 5,446
64 Katelyn 5,421
65 Paige 5,342
66 Laura 5,227
67 Madeline 4,911
68 Cheyenne 4,866
69 Jacqueline 4,862
70 Kristen 4,851
71 Heather 4,759
72 Briana 4,735
73 Kelly 4,734
74 Breanna 4,701
75 Mackenzie 4,597
76 Miranda 4,568
77 Alexandria 4,562
78 Caroline 4,466
79 Erica 4,460
80 Shannon 4,337
81 Katie 4,328
82 Monica 4,326
83 Jenna 4,288
84 Caitlin 4,268
85 Bailey 4,192
86 Lindsey 4,112
87 Kathryn 4,102
88 Amy 4,067
89 Cassandra 4,017
90 Angela 3,867
91 Alicia 3,861
92 Crystal 3,786
93 Hailey 3,763
94 Grace 3,741
95 Catherine 3,739
96 Jamie 3,599
97 Angelica 3,404
98 Leah 3,327
99 Molly 3,312
100 Alexa 3,260
